arm64: dts: rockchip: Add capacity-dmips-mhz attributes to rk3399

The RK3399 has the interesting property to be a so called "big-little"
system, where not all the CPUs are equal (the A53s are much weaker
than the A72s).

So far, we're not telling the OS that there is such a difference in
processing capacity, and Linux assumes that they are equal. Too bad.

Let's tell the OS about this by using the capacity-dmips-mhz
property. The values used here are those used on the Juno platform,
which is quite similar. This leads to the scheduler knowing that
it can pack more tasks on the A72s, and leads to a better interactive
experience.
